UNPKG

synapse-react-client

Version:

[![Build Status](https://travis-ci.com/Sage-Bionetworks/Synapse-React-Client.svg?branch=main)](https://travis-ci.com/Sage-Bionetworks/Synapse-React-Client) [![npm version](https://badge.fury.io/js/synapse-react-client.svg)](https://badge.fury.io/js/synaps

25 lines (24 loc) 840 B
import * as React from 'react'; import { ColumnIconConfigs } from '../../CardContainerLogic'; declare type State = { isShowMoreOn: boolean; isDesktop: boolean; }; declare type CardFooterProps = { values: any[]; isHeader: boolean; secondaryLabelLimit?: number; columnIconOptions?: ColumnIconConfigs; className?: string; }; declare class CardFooter extends React.Component<CardFooterProps, State> { constructor(props: CardFooterProps); toggleShowMore(): void; componentDidMount(): void; componentWillUnmount(): void; updatePredicate(): void; renderRowValue: (columnName: string, value: string, tableColumnName: string) => string | JSX.Element; renderRows: (values: string[][], limit: number, isDesktop: boolean) => JSX.Element[]; render(): JSX.Element; } export default CardFooter;